There are around 175 languages spoken in the Philippines, with the most widely spoken being Tagalog (Filipino), Cebuano, Ilocano, Hiligaynon, and Waray. These languages have their own regional dialects and variations, reflecting the cultural and linguistic diversity of the country.

Where is the 8 major dialects in the Philippines spoken?

The 8 major dialects in the Philippines are spoken across different regions of the country. These dialects are Tagalog (Central Luzon and Manila), Cebuano (Visayas and Mindanao), Ilocano (Northern Luzon), Hiligaynon or Ilonggo (Western Visayas), Waray (Eastern Visayas), Kapampangan (Central Luzon), Pangasinan (Northern Luzon), and Bikol (Bicol region).

Are Filipino and Tagalog languages the same?

Filipino and Tagalog are related but not exactly the same. Tagalog is the basis of the Filipino language, which is the official language of the Philippines. Filipino incorporates words from other Philippine languages and English, making it more inclusive than Tagalog.
